Endoscopic retrograde … WebFor diagnosis alone, doctors may use noninvasive tests—tests that do not physically enter the body—instead of ERCP. Noninvasive tests such as magnetic resonance cholangiopancreatography (MRCP)—a type of mag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) —are safer and can also diagnose many problems of the bile and pancreatic ducts. WebMR enterography carries some risks: The magnetic field may change the way any implanted medical devices work. The intravenous contrast may damage the kidneys, especially if your kidneys are not working well. Some people have an allergic reaction to the contrast dye. MIPS Stanford University Molecular Imaging Program at Stanford School of Medicine Department of Radiology ... china imbiss gladbeck horster strWebCholecystitis (ko-luh-sis-TIE-tis) is inflammation of the gallbladder. It usually occurs when drainage from the gallbladder becomes blocked (often from a gallstone). It may be acute (come on suddenly) and cause severe pain in the upper abdomen.
